UPSC CDS Eligibility Criteria – Age Limit for Combined Defence Services

The eligibility criteria for the UPSC Combined Defence Services (CDS) examination are as follows:

Nationality:

  • A candidate must be one of the following:
    • A citizen of India.
    • A subject of Nepal or Bhutan.
    • A Tibetan refugee who came to India before January 1, 1962, with the intention of permanently settling in India.
    • A person of Indian origin who has migrated from Pakistan, Burma, Sri Lanka, East African countries of Kenya, Uganda, the United Republic of Tanzania, Zambia, Malawi, Zaire, Ethiopia, or Vietnam with the intention of permanently settling in India.

Age Limit for UPSC CDS – Combined Defence Services

  • The age limits for different academies and services are as follows:
    • For Indian Military Academy (IMA): Candidates must be between 19 and 24 years old.
    • For Indian Naval Academy (INA): Candidates must be between 19 and 24 years old.
    • For Air Force Academy (AFA): Candidates must be between 19 and 24 years old.
    • For Officers’ Training Academy (OTA) for Men: Candidates must be between 19 and 25 years old.
    • For Officers’ Training Academy (OTA) for Women: Candidates must be between 19 and 25 years old.
  • The age is calculated as of the date mentioned in the official CDS notification for the respective examination year.

Educational Qualifications:

  • The educational qualifications vary based on the academy and service for which a candidate is applying. Generally, candidates should have a bachelor’s degree from a recognized university or institution.
  • For INA, candidates should have a degree in Engineering.
  • For AFA, candidates should have a degree with Physics and Mathematics at the 10+2 level or a Bachelor of Engineering.
  • There is no specific subject requirement for OTA, and candidates should have a bachelor’s degree from a recognized university.

Marital Status:

  • For OTA, both men and women can apply, but candidates should be unmarried at the time of application.

Physical and Medical Standards:

  • Candidates should be in good physical and medical health as per the standards prescribed by the respective services. Detailed physical and medical standards are mentioned in the official UPSC CDS notification.

Candidates should carefully check the official UPSC CDS notification for the specific examination year they plan to apply for to confirm the eligibility criteria and any other requirements or conditions.
